What is the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ate?
The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ate is essential for managing state tax withholding for employees in Connecticut. It plays a crucial role in determining the amount of state tax withheld from wages, ensuring compliance with Connecticut tax laws. The CT-W4 form requires individuals to indicate their tax withholding preferences and provides a structured method for employers to withhold the correct amount from employee paychecks.
Accurate withholding is vital to prevent tax-related complications. By completing this form correctly, employees can avoid overpaying or underpaying their state taxes throughout the year, thereby enhancing their financial management.

Who Needs the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ate?
The primary audience for the CT-W4 form comprises employees in Connecticut. Anyone commencing employment, changing jobs, or altering personal tax situations should complete this form. This includes both full-time and part-time workers across various employment sectors.
Eligibility criteria include having income that is subject to Connecticut state tax and needing to adjust withholding amounts based on life changes, such as marriage or the birth of a child. Understanding these scenarios is essential for all employees to ensure proper tax withholding.

Who needs to fill out the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ate?
Any employee working in Connecticut who wishes to certify their tax withholding status to their employer must fill out the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ate.
What information is required to complete this form?
You will need personal details such as name, address, Social Security Number, and your expected annual gross income to accurately complete the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ate.
Is there a deadline for submitting the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ate?
There is no strict deadline for submitting this form, but it’s advisable to complete it as soon as you start your employment or when your tax situation changes.
How can I submit the completed form to my employer?
After filling out the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ate on pdfFiller, you can save it as a PDF and email it to your employer or print and hand it in directly.
What are common mistakes to avoid when completing this form?
Common mistakes include entering incorrect Social Security Numbers, failing to sign the form, or not choosing the correct withholding code based on your status.
Do I need to notarize the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ate?
No, the Connecticut Employee’s Withholding Certificate does not require notarization; simply complete and sign the form before submitting it to your employer.
What is the processing time for updating my withholding status?
Processing time varies by employer; however, it typically takes a pay cycle or two for updates to reflect on your paycheck once submitted.
